The TVS Sport commuter motorcycle has received a new ES Plus variant at Rs 60,881 (ex-showroom). Positioned between the ES and ELS variants, this new trim is available with two new colour schemes, featuring revised graphics on the fuel tank, front fender, headlight cowl, side body panels, and rim decals.
TVS Sport variant | Colour Options | Ex-showroom Price (Delhi) |
ES | Starlight Blue, All Red, All Black and All Grey | Rs 59,881 |
ES PLus | Black Neon, Grey Red | Rs 60,881 |
ELS | Black Blue, Black Red, White Purple and Metallic Blue | Rs 71,785 |
TVS has also introduced a new USB charging port for the bike for added convenience.

Powering the TVS Sport is a 110cc, single-cylinder, FI engine that produces 8.2PS and 8.7Nm. The same engine also powers the TVS Radeon and Star City Plus. This engine is known for its high fuel efficiency. It can easily return a mileage of around 83 km/l. It has a top speed of 90 kmph and a kerb weight of 112kg.
Regarding features, the TVS Sport comes with a long single-piece seat with soft cushioning, a single-piece grab rail, an electric start system, a halogen headlamp with LED position lamp, and an analogue instrument cluster.
In the 110cc segment, the TVS Sport takes on the likes of Hero HF Deluxe, Bajaj Platina 110 and Honda CD 110.
